Zapatista Souvenirs
canuckmike profile photo

2.5 out of 5 starsHelpfulness

canuckmike 552 reviews

What to buy: The Zapatisitas (Zapatisita Army of National Liberation, EZLN) are a revolutionary group located in Chiapas that has a lot of the same ideals as other revolutionary groups. Against global corporation and power to the local indigenous population. Subcomadante Marcos is their military leader and spokesperson but not the overall grand poobah of the organization. They went public in 1994 to protest NAFTA which didn't result in much. They have for the time being stopped using since their initial uprising resulted in the Mexican military coming down on them pretty hard. Now they try to spread their word by the internet and NGOs.

Like other revolutionaries and revolutionary groups, merchandise has been made of them. I don't know if any of the money goes to support them or not but I'm sure it does at some places. From where I was I mostly saw postcards and tshirts. I'm sure there is more out there. It's an interesting souvenir to say the least and a good present for that junior revolutionary.
